Company Overview
HWM’s market capitalization of 73.09 billion USD is significantly greater than AER’s 20.46 billion USD, highlighting its more substantial market valuation.
With betas of 1.40 for AER and 1.43 for HWM, both stocks show similar sensitivity to overall market movements.
Symbol | AER | HWM |
---|---|---|
Company Name | AerCap Holdings N.V. | Howmet Aerospace Inc. |
Country | IE | US |
Sector | Industrials | Industrials |
Industry | Rental & Leasing Services | Industrial - Machinery |
CEO | Aengus Kelly | John C. Plant FCA |
Price | 115.89 USD | 181.06 USD |
Market Cap | 20.46 billion USD | 73.09 billion USD |
Beta | 1.40 | 1.43 |
Exchange | NYSE | NYSE |
IPO Date | November 21, 2006 | November 1, 2016 |
ADR | No | No |

Profitability at a Glance
Symbol | AER | HWM |
---|---|---|
Return on Equity (TTM) | 12.55% | 27.72% |
Return on Assets (TTM) | 2.95% | 11.66% |
Return on Invested Capital (TTM) | 3.17% | 15.87% |
Net Profit Margin (TTM) | 26.77% | 16.64% |
Operating Profit Margin (TTM) | 32.92% | 23.58% |
Gross Profit Margin (TTM) | 38.97% | 30.46% |

Financial Strength at a Glance
Symbol | AER | HWM |
---|---|---|
Current Ratio (TTM) | 3.12 | 2.30 |
Quick Ratio (TTM) | 3.06 | 1.07 |
Debt-to-Equity Ratio (TTM) | 2.69 | 0.73 |
Debt-to-Asset Ratio (TTM) | 0.64 | 0.32 |
Net Debt-to-EBITDA Ratio (TTM) | 8.63 | 1.49 |
Interest Coverage Ratio (TTM) | 5.50 | 10.35 |

Valuation at a Glance
Symbol | AER | HWM |
---|---|---|
Price-to-Earnings Ratio (P/E, TTM) | 9.85 | 58.38 |
Forward PEG Ratio (TTM) | 1.33 | 3.32 |
Price-to-Sales Ratio (P/S, TTM) | 2.56 | 9.68 |
Price-to-Book Ratio (P/B, TTM) | 1.22 | 15.30 |
Price-to-Free Cash Flow Ratio (P/FCF, TTM) | -9.80 | 71.94 |
EV-to-EBITDA (TTM) | 12.54 | 38.46 |
EV-to-Sales (TTM) | 8.22 | 10.07 |
